Summary

The third chapter opens at the Deer Run Correctional Institute, where Rich Devlin has worked as a corrections officer for ten years, since the prison opened. When opening was announced and the jobs posted, 500 Bakerton residents applied for the 65 jobs. It is still competitive to get a prison job ten years later. On this Friday morning in the Spring of 2012, Rich makes his rounds at the end of his shift, talking with the inmates who welcome conversation and walking by those who prefer not to.

After his shift ends, Rich helps tend bar at the Commercial, his father Dick Devlin’s bar on the first floor of a local hotel.
